Mary Astor
Born: Lucille Vasconsellos Langhanke
Birth: May 3, 1906 in Quincy Illinois.
Death: Sept 25, 1987 - Woodland Hills, CA
Occupation: Actress
Years Active: 1920's- 1964
Began as a Teenager in silent movies 1921, made a sucessful transition to talkies
Most famous role as Brigid O'Shaunessy in Maltese Falcon with Humphrey Bogart 1941.
Won Oscar for Best supporting actress in The Great Lie 1941. Acted in movies, stage and Tv
into the 60's and was the author of five novels. Autobiography became a best seller as did her book
Life on Film about her career.
